Frequently Asked Questions about Glenwood

How much are Studio apartments in Glenwood?

There are currently 6 Studio Apartments in Glenwood with rent ranges from $545 to $1,445 with an average price of $1,290.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Glenwood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Glenwood ranges from $645 to $1,875 with an average monthly rent of $1,299.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Glenwood c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Glenwood range from $590 to $2,060.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,218.

How expensive are Glenwood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 29 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Glenwood on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$689 to $2,300 - averaging $1,412 for the location.
